Python 3.2与3.1有什么区别?

0 投票
1 回答
822 浏览
提问于 2025-04-17 04:15

我是个新手程序员

我决定全心投入学习Python,发现有不同的版本,比如Python 3.2、3.1等等。有人能告诉我这些版本之间有什么区别吗?如果我学了一个旧版本,之后还需要重新学习新版本吗?还是说只是对库和其他东西进行了更新?抱歉如果这个问题听起来很简单,我还是个新手。

1 个回答

5

你可以查看一下Python 3.2 的发布说明,里面有具体的信息。其实在3.2和3.1之间,你不会发现什么语法上的差别或者问题,特别是如果你刚开始学习的话。你完全不需要担心先学一个再学另一个,它们基本上是一样的。

另外,Python在向后兼容性方面做得很好,所以你在3.1中做的几乎所有事情在3.2中也能正常工作。

不过,Python 2.x和3.x之间有明显的区别,语法和一些工作方式上都有变化。即使如此,如果你学过Python 2.7,了解了这些区别后,你也能在几分钟内搞懂3.2。

撰写回答